Scaling Together: Community-Driven Load Testing for Python Apps

Steve Yonkeu

English Session #webserver

Performance bottlenecks can make or break your app, but load testing often gets pushed aside during development. In the open-source world, why aren’t we treating performance testing as a shared responsibility? This talk shows how developers, testers, and infrastructure engineers can collaborate to build scalable Python applications.

We’ll use a Django case study and Apache JMeter to demonstrate effective stress-testing techniques and common pitfalls to avoid. We’ll also explore open-source tools like Locust and k6, and discuss how the community can contribute by sharing test plans, scripts, and best practices. Think of it as open-sourcing your load testing strategy.

Beyond the technical aspects, this session emphasizes collective knowledge. Imagine a world where shared test suites and benchmarking efforts become the norm—where Python apps benefit from community-driven testing.

Speakers:


Steve Yonkeu is a backend software engineer dedicated to delivering excellence in architecture, performance, and modularity. For over 5 years he has been leading teams and projects and open source communities worldwide. Steve is also the founder of Django Cameroon and Python Cameroon communities and today. He is also an organizer at PyCon Africa.